Dandelions

May 2, 2017 by Lisa 2 Comments


Dandelion with falcate orange tip

Dandelions may be an eyesore to some but not to us. In fact we like them so much we eat them!

An annual dandelion festival is held in Ohio Amish Country in early May.  You can taste dandelion wine and lots of other dandelion foods! Learn more at Breitenbach Winery’s website.
